Loft Beds With Desk For Kids and Teens

Kids and teens can maximize their bedroom space by installing loft beds that include a desk. Pick a painted loft bed with stairs for an easy climb or a staircase built into the frame for safety and a sleek appearance.

This loft bed with built-in desk and shelves gives an attractive industrial design that makes the most of the space in your room. The frame is able to accommodate an entire mattress and comes with an slat kit for plywood and guard rails.

Space-saving Design

A loft bed with a desk requires less space than furniture that is separate for the bedroom. This lets you allocate more room in the room to other purposes, such as an area to sit or even a home office. Most importantly, it allows you to create a study or sleeping space that is suited to your child or teen's preferences and needs.

Keyboard Trays

A keyboard tray is among the best features some loft beds with desks provide. These are convenient for children who use laptops or a desktop computer and offer an easier typing position than sitting on the floor. You can find models that sit directly on top of the desk or on top bunk single Mattress; escortexxx.ca, of the frame, depending on how much space you have available. Some models come with an open drawer for keyboards that slides out, while others come with built-in desk storage.

A loft bed with desks also provide ample storage space under the bed. It keeps things away from view and out of the mind. It also prevents clutter which can distract some children when they are working. The kinds of storage options available are varied, but generally comprise closed cabinets, drawers, and open shelves. Closed cabinets are a great way to store clothes and other things that you don't want to display. Open shelves are great for books and decorative elements.

Another fantastic feature that loft beds that come with desks include is the ability to adjust the height of the bed. You can alter the height of the bed to meet your child's requirements. This makes the loft bed an ideal option for families with multiple children as it grows with your family, without having to buy a new bed.
